Как прикрепить файл к среде Postman?
Как я могу прикрепить файл к среде, чтобы запустить коллекцию в модуле запуска Postman? Файл прикреплен к данным формы, и вручную запрос выполняется нормально, но как только я запускаю его в средстве сбора данных, средство не видит файл, и возникает ошибка 500 Internal server. Как можно решить эту проблему?
1 ответ
Тело запроса. См. Подробности в ссылке. При создании запросов вы будете часто работать с редактором тела запроса. Почтальон позволяет отправлять практически любые HTTP-запросы. Редактор тела разделен на 4 области и имеет различные элементы управления, в зависимости от типа тела.
Примечание о заголовках. Когда вы отправляете запросы по протоколу HTTP, ваш сервер может ожидать заголовок типа содержимого. Заголовок Content-Type позволяет серверу правильно анализировать тело. Для данных формы и телосложения с urlencoded Postman автоматически присоединяет правильный заголовок Content-Type, поэтому вам не нужно его устанавливать. Заголовок необработанного режима устанавливается при выборе типа форматирования. Если вы вручную используете заголовок Content-Type, это значение имеет приоритет над тем, что устанавливает Postman. Почтальон не устанавливает тип заголовка для двоичного типа тела.
Форма-данные Форма-данные
multipart / form-data - кодировка по умолчанию, используемая веб-формой для передачи данных. Это имитирует заполнение формы на веб-сайте и ее отправку. Редактор форм-данных позволяет вам устанавливать пары ключ-значение (используя редактор данных для ваших данных. Вы также можете прикреплять файлы к ключу. Примечание: из-за ограничений спецификации HTML 5 файлы не сохраняются в истории или коллекциях Вам нужно будет снова выбрать файл при следующей отправке запроса.
Загрузка нескольких файлов, каждый со своим собственным Content-Type, пока не поддерживается. Смотрите изображение здесь в ссылке